Won Bass is very excited to announce the “ALL NEW” entry and payout structure for our 4 stand alone Pro/Am events scheduled for the 2013 season. We are pleased to offer an all inclusive entry fee, which includes great Optional payouts based on 100 boat fields. Entries or deposits must be received prior to official practice at each event. No entries will be accepted after official practice has begun. Official practice is always the 2 days prior to an event.
Also new for 2013, Won Bass will no longer be accepting AAA entries with Pro entries. AAA anglers will be put on the waiting list based on when deposits are received. Once the Pro’s start registering for the event, those AAA anglers who signed up early with deposits will be paired and guaranteed in that tournament. Make sure to get signed up early. Won bass will also be offering an “Early Bird” raffle for each of the 4 Pro/Am events. Those who sign up earlier than 3 weeks befor the deadline will be entered to win a FREE entry to that event. One Pro and One AAA winner will be awarded at each event.
The winners of each Pro/Am events, both Pro and AAA, will win a FREE entry into the 2013 U.S. Open at Lake Mead in September.

Below are our event entry amounts and deposit requirements:
Pro/Am’s = 4 events
Oroville Feb 2-3– Delta March 2-3 – Havasu March 16-17 – Roosevelt May 4-5
Pro Entry = $700
Deposit = $200
AAA Entry = $400
Deposit = $100
NEW!!!!!Cal Opens = 2 events
Clear Lake June 10-12 – DVL April 5-7
Pro Entry = $1000
Deposit = $200
AAA Entry = $400
Deposit = $100
U.S. Open Sept 9-11
Pro Entry = $2000
Deposit = $600
AAA Entry = $600
Deposit = $200
